A Hydrafacial treatment is a non invasive, multi step facial that combines cleansing, exfoliation, extraction, hydration infusion, and antioxidant protection in one streamlined treatment. It uses patented technology known as vortex technology, along with a specialized Hydrafacial tip, to deeply cleanse the skin and remove debris from pores.
Unlike traditional facials or facial microdermabrasion, Hydrafacial involves a controlled exfoliation process that gently removes dead skin cells from the outer layer of the skin while simultaneously infusing it with nourishing serums. It’s considered a form of non-ablative facial rejuvenation because it improves skin without damaging the surface.
This treatment is proven safe for most skin types and addresses a wide range of specific skin concerns, including acne, fine lines, sun damage, clogged pores, and uneven skin tone.
The Hydrafacial treatment follows a structured three step approach that delivers smooth results without irritation.
First, gentle exfoliation removes dead skin cells and clears away buildup from pores. This step helps unclogging pores and prepares the skin for deeper penetration of active ingredients.
Next, the device uses vortex technology to extract impurities. Unlike manual extractions, which can be uncomfortable, this system uses suction to remove debris and excess oil production from pores while keeping the skin calm.
Finally, a hydration infusion delivers a customized blend of hyaluronic acid and antioxidant serum into the skin. This topical antioxidant application enhances overall skin health and helps strengthen the skin barrier.
The result is a radiant complexion, improved skin texture, and visible skin refinement in just one treatment.

When comparing Hydrafacials to chemical peels or other treatments, the biggest difference is comfort and recovery time. Chemical peels can be highly effective but may involve visible peeling and several days of downtime.
The Hydrafacial treatment is immediately effective and requires no recovery time. You can return to your daily routine right after your appointment, making it ideal before an event or busy week.
While other treatments may focus on one issue at a time, this treatment deeply cleanse, exfoliates, hydrates, and protects in a single session. That combination is what sets it apart from traditional facials and many other skin treatments.
